A recent study has shown that nearly half of all heart attacks occur without any symptoms, making them “silent” and incredibly dangerous. However, medical technology company Fountain Life is revolutionizing heart health by utilizing artificial intelligence (AI) to detect heart attack risk years before symptoms begin.

Developed by Fountain Life, the AI coronary artery scan is a simple outpatient procedure that takes less than an hour to complete. According to Bill Kapp, CEO of Fountain Life and an orthopedic surgeon with a background in molecular immunology and genetics, the scan can accurately identify heart attack risks three, five, or even 10 years in advance.

The procedure involves injecting a dye into the vein, followed by a quick CAT scan of the heart. The AI algorithm then analyzes the results, providing detailed information about plaque buildup, including the amount and type of plaque present. This information is crucial in determining the stability of the plaque and the potential risk of rupture.

Compared to the traditional Coronary Computed Tomography Angiography (CCTA), which relies on human interpretation, the AI technology offers a more accurate and detailed assessment. It can identify uncalcified plaque, which is softer and prone to rupture, enabling early intervention and potential reversal of heart disease.

Fountain Life’s AI coronary artery scan offers a non-invasive alternative to the standard “cath lab” procedure, which involves inserting a catheter into the artery. This makes it more accessible and cost-effective for patients.

Leading cardiologist Dr. Ernst von Schwarz acknowledges the instrumental role of AI in body imaging techniques. He believes that AI can greatly assist in the early detection of plaques and guide treatment decisions before adverse events occur.

Raman Velu, a 62-year-old real estate investment consultant from Dallas, Texas, experienced the life-saving potential of the AI coronary artery scan. Despite living an active lifestyle and considering himself healthy, Velu discovered that he had three potential blockages in his arteries through the scan. He subsequently underwent bypass surgery, avoiding a potential emergency situation.

The risk associated with the AI artery scan is minimal, involving only low-dose radiation comparable to a transatlantic flight. However, individuals with kidney issues or an intolerance to the dye injection should avoid the procedure.
